    I’ve created a Copilot agent in Copilot Studio that connects to Dynamics 365 Finance and Operations to create customer master records. When I test the agent inside Copilot Studio (Test your agent), everything works perfectly.

    However, once I publish the agent to Microsoft Teams and try to create a customer master record, I receive this error message:

    An error has occurred. Error code: ConnectorRequestFailure Conversation Id: [ID] (UTC: [timestamp])
     
    It seems like the connector is timing out or failing to connect when the agent runs through Teams, even though it works fine in the test environment.

    I’ve already tried:

    Reconnecting the D365 connection

    Republishing the agent

    Verifying that the same environment is used

    Checking that the connector timeout isn’t exceeded

    But the issue still persists.

    Could anyone help me understand:

    1. Why the connector might be failing only when accessed from Teams?

    2. Whether there are different timeout limits or authentication paths when an agent is run from Teams?

    3. Any recommended steps to resolve the ConnectorRequestFailure error in this scenario?
